petsc-3.13.6 2020-09-29
Report Typos and Errors

PetscMemoryView

Shows the amount of memory currently being used in a communicator.

Synopsis

#include "petscsys.h" 
PetscErrorCode  PetscMemoryView(PetscViewer viewer,const char message[])
Collective on PetscViewer

Input Parameter

viewer - the viewer that defines the communicator
message - string printed before values

Options Database

-malloc_debug - have PETSc track how much memory it has allocated
-memory_view - during PetscFinalize() have this routine called

See Also

PetscMallocDump(), PetscMemoryGetCurrentUsage(), PetscMemorySetGetMaximumUsage(), PetscMallocView()

Level

intermediate

Location

src/sys/memory/mtr.c
Index of all Sys routines
Table of Contents for all manual pages
Index of all manual pages